With RE5 already on sale in some release date-breaking stores in Japan, we bloggers only have a very breif period of time to report on the games features like they are "news". So here is what will likely be the last new thing you hear from me about the game; it has the same Mercenaries mode as RE4

This is the best thing I've heard about the game in a while. I love RE4's  Mercenaries mode (which is part of why I liked Dead Rising: Chop Till You Drop), so to see the mode (and J.J.) make a return puts a big smile on my face. More importantly, the mode appears to feature something I didn't think I'd see in RE5; NO MANDATORY CO-OP! With that, my biggest complaint about the game has essentially been fixed, if not just for this one mode. 

I easily spent more than eighty hours playing RE4 Mercenaries, which is ten times as longer than RE5's reported playtime. The news that the game was so short had me bummed at first, but now that I know it has Mercenaries for sure, I don't care about the campaign's length. I'll put at least another eighty hours into RE5 with this mode alone.
